Soccer Squad: Missing! by Bali Rai

Dal, Chris, Abs and Jason have made the squad for the local youth club under-lls football team. And after their first match (not as successful as they'd have liked), they are determined to prove that they've got what it takes to be winners. The Rushton Reds have lost their first two matches. Missed chances, missed goals - even missed penalties! Their coaches say they need to play more as a team - and they have an idea for a great team-building day. But will it help the Reds hit the back of the net?

Having grown up in the heart of Leicester's Sikh community, Bali Rai went to London to study Politics. After managing a bar and thinking about becoming a journalist, he now devotes all his time to writing and visiting schools to talk about his books. He is the author of a number of titles for the Random House Children's list, several of which have won awards or been shortlisted; including Unarranged Marriage, which won four regional awards and was shortlisted for five others!The Whisper was shortlisted for the prestigious BookTrust Teenage Prize. Soccer Squad is his first younger book for the RHCB lists.
